Q: Is 42,166,045 a Prime Number?
A: No, 42,166,045 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 42166045 can be evenly divided by 1 5 31 155 272,039 1,360,195 8,433,209 and 42,166,045, with no remainder.
Since 42,166,045 cannot be divided by just 1 and 42,166,045, it is not a prime number.
